2. Tips for Setting a Strong Netgear Ext Password
When setting an Ext password for your Netgear router, you’ll want to make sure it’s as secure as possible for your network. Here are some great tips to help you take the necessary steps to create a strong, reliable password.
- Length: Make sure your password is long enough; choose one with at least 12 characters or more.
- Include numbers: It’s best to also include at least one number in your password.
- Mix it up: A good idea is to mix upper and lower case letters, symbols and numbers in your password.
- Avoid “easy” words: Avoid using single words like “password” or names or numbers like birth dates, anniversary dates, etc.
In addition to making your password stronger, also make sure you’re changing it regularly. Network security is a constant battle so make sure to stay updated and create daily/weekly/monthly passwords if necessary. That way, it’s nearly impossible for a hacker to find out your password and gain access.
3. How Your Password Protects Your Netgear Ext Network?
Password-Protect your Netgear Ext Network
Having an unprotected Netgear Ext Network can have undesirable consequences like information leakage, personal data loss, and system exploitation. To ensure safety for you and your family, you’ll need to password-protect your network. Here’s how:
1. Set a strong and secure password: Create a unique password for your network, using special characters, numbers and a mix of upper and lower-case letters. Make sure your password is difficult to guess, and never share it with anyone you don’t trust.
2. Enable WPA2: WPA2 is an encryption protocol that scrambles the data and makes your connection secure. The best way to enable WPA2 is to enable it from the router settings once it is connected to your network.
3. Configure your Wi-Fi settings: You should turn off broadcasting your name (SSID) if possible, in order to hide your network from hackers and intruders. You should also enable MAC address filtering, which only allows approved devices to join your network.
By taking these steps, you can make sure your Netgear Ext Network is secure and protected against unwanted access. You’ll be able to relax knowing that your sensitive data is kept safe and secure.
